Title: United War Work Campaign scrapbook
Date (inclusive): 1918
Collection Number: XX790
Contributing Institution: Hoover Institution Library and Archives
Language of Material: English
Physical Description: 1 volume (0.2 Linear Feet)
Abstract: Posters, pamphlets, leaflets, flyers, and pledge cards, issued during the week of 1918 November 11-18, relating to war work fundraising. Autographed by Bruce Barton, publicity director, and other Campaign officials.
Creator: Barton, Bruce, 1886-1967
Creator: United War Work Campaign, Inc

Biographical/Historical Note

American private organization coordinating fundraising for World War I war work with American servicemen.
